Home Office Design Requirements for Productive Remote Work
Home offices in remote worker destinations need more than a desk in a corner. Proper ergonomic design includes dedicated electrical circuits for computer equipment, network cabling or mesh WiFi systems capable of supporting video conferencing, window placement that minimizes screen glare, and sound-dampening insulation between the office space and other rooms. Builders and renovators targeting the remote worker market should consider these features standard rather than optional. The return on investment for home office infrastructure is substantial: properties with dedicated, well-designed workspaces command higher prices and rent faster than comparable homes without them.
Accessory Dwelling Units as Remote Work Spaces
Accessory dwelling units, sometimes called granny flats or backyard cottages, have become popular solutions for remote work housing. These detached structures separate work life from home life physically, a distinction many remote workers value. ADUs can function as combined living and working spaces for single occupants or as dedicated offices for homeowners who live in the main house. Towns that have updated zoning codes to permit ADUs by right rather than through special permitting processes have seen faster adoption of this housing type.

Connectivity and Digital Infrastructure Requirements
Fast, reliable internet connectivity is the single most important infrastructure requirement for remote work destinations. Towns that lack broadband access cannot compete for digital nomads regardless of their other attractions. Fiber optic connections delivering symmetrical upload and download speeds of at least 100 Mbps are the baseline, with gigabit service increasingly expected. Beyond raw speed, latency, reliability, and customer service quality all factor into whether a town can support remote professionals. Remote workers also need reliable mobile connectivity for working from coffee shops, parks, and co-working spaces. Co-Working Space Design and Economics
Successful co-working spaces in small towns share several design features. Open-plan areas provide affordable access for transient users, while private phone booths and conference rooms support professional calls and client meetings. Meeting room capacity of 4 to 8 people matches the typical small team size for remote project work. Kitchen facilities, secure bike storage, and after-hours access policies distinguish premium spaces from basic offerings. The economics of co-working in small towns differ from urban markets: lower rent is offset by lower density, so operators must keep membership pricing accessible while covering fixed costs through community event space rentals and corporate membership tiers.

Energy Efficiency as a Remote Worker Priority
Remote workers who spend most of their time at home are more sensitive to energy costs and indoor environmental quality than commuters. Proper insulation, high-efficiency HVAC systems, triple-pane windows, and smart thermostats reduce operating costs while improving comfort during work hours. Builders targeting this market should spec these features as standard rather than upgrades. Energy-efficient homes command premium prices and attract remote workers who value both lower utility bills and environmental responsibility.
